ORLANDO'S KIA CENTER HOSTS AN UNPRECEDENTED 27 EVENTS IN THE MONTH OF MARCH

 

 

ORLANDO, FLORIDA [April, 2024] — Kia Center, Orlando's premier sports and entertainment destination, triumphantly wrapped a blockbuster month of March by hosting 27 different events over its 31 days and welcoming 291,619 patrons through its doors. During that time, the award-winning arena was teeming with a diverse lineup of 10 concerts/events, 10 Orlando Magic games and seven Orlando Solar Bears games.

 

Several of the biggest names in music graced Kia Center’s stage including sold-out performances by the Eagles (The Long Goodbye Tour), Olivia Rodrigo (GUTS World Tour), Fall Out Boy (So Much for 2our Dust), Tim McGraw (Standing Room Only Tour ‘24) and Nicki Minaj (Pink Friday 2 World Tour). The constant activity yielded 20 floor conversion configurations to accommodate basketball, ice hockey, concerts, comedy shows and mixed martial arts, among other events.

About Kia Center

Kia Center, owned and operated by the City of Orlando on behalf of the Central Florida community, hosts major national events, concerts and family shows since its opening in the Fall of 2010. The Orlando Magic served as the developer and the facility was designed to reflect the character of the community, meet the goals of the users and build on the legacy of sports and entertainment in Orlando. The building’s exterior features a modern blend of glass and metal materials, along with ever-changing graphics via a monumental wall along one facade. A 180-foot tall tower serves as a beacon amid the downtown skyline. The 875,000 square foot,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design (LEED) Gold-certified building features a sustainable, environmentally-friendly design and unmatched technology, including 1,100 digital monitors, the tallest high-definition video board in an NBA venue and multiple premium amenities available to all patrons in the building. Kia Center was honored with the International Association of Venue Managers' Venue Excellence Award, which is bestowed upon facilities that excel in the management and operation of public assembly venues. Kia Center was the only arena to garner this distinction. Additionally, the arena has earned numerous awards, which most notably includes TheStadiumBusiness Awards’ 2013 Customer Experience Award and was named SportsBusiness Journal's 2012 Sports Facility of the Year.
